Yael Lehmann leaves The Food Trust
September 20, 2019
Category: Featured, People, Short
The Food Trust announced, late Friday afternoon, that its president and CEO, Yael Lehmann has left the organization.
“Yael led the organization’s evolution from a local nonprofit to a nationally recognized food access organization,” the announcement stated. “We honor her dedication to the organization’s mission. We wish her well in her future endeavors and sincerely appreciate her contributions to The Food Trust throughout her 18 years of service.”
The Food Trust’s founder, Duane Perry, has been tapped to help guide the organization through the transition and its search for a new CEO.
Although Perry is stepping in to help, the organization is not officially naming him interim CEO, according to Senior Associate for Communications Carolyn Huckabay.
